No, the truly random one is Kentucky and Western Kentucky going to a different state to play a non-conference game.
They are playing it in Nashville as a home game for WKU. In case you have never been in the area. Bowling Green (home of WKU) is just north of the TN line while Nashville is just south of it. The stadium in Nashville (69,143) is much bigger than WKU's own stadium (22,113) so it actually makes pretty good sense if they fill it.
